Your actual pay will be based on your skills and experience — talk with your recruiter to learn more.Base pay rangeCA$106,000.00/yr - CA$133,000.00/yrDepartment:Product Creation DevelopmentReports to:Senior Director, Product Creation DevelopmentLocation:North Vancouver, BCYour Opportunity at ARC’TERYX:As the Manager, Commercialization, you are the commercialization expert in your designated product category. You understand the unique needs of your category to lead, support and guide a team of specialists in their efforts to develop and deliver the technical specifications and factory competencies to be buy ready and production ready, while meeting product cost strategies, quality and manufacturing standards and efficiency. You provide insight and recommend sustainable strategies for your product category to continuously improve speed, optimize total product cost, support margin, and best utilize supply chain capability and efficiencies to achieve the product intent, function, and performance with integrity.Core activitiesBuilding, leading, coaching, and guiding a high performing team of Technical Commercialization Specialists who manage the buy ready and production ready process at our factoriesManaging workload between team members and calendar requirements to ensure timelines are met throughout the commercialization processLeading, training, and guiding a team of commercialization specialists to improve scalability, efficiency, and quality in our manufacturing baseManaging the new model product specification process from fit approval to bulk production enabling the accurate planning of raw materials to meet our quality and delivery expectationsEnsuring the seasonal carryover and transition process supports Supply Chain team needs and seasonal updates are metManaging processes and planning workload to ensure timelines are met to support delivery expectationsReporting and driving improvement on key performance metrics that deliver speed, quality, cost, and efficiencyReporting team performance metrics regularly to management team (e.G., product category execution against the corporate calendar, workflow, team capacity vs seasonal requirements)Managing the standard documentation process to provide sufficient detail to accurately produce finish goods, maintain an accurate database of BOM (Bill of Materials) information,



aid raw material commitments and support Quality processesSupporting with the building of direct development to extend our development capacity and ensure Arc’teryx continues to achieve state of the art opportunities for product innovationProposing sourcing strategies for your product category to optimize total product cost, support margin, and best utilize supply chain capabilities and efficienciesPartnering with Sourcing and their strategy to provide recommendation for the seasonal model allocation for your product category.Supporting Sourcing partners on the assessment of new factories needed to support growth, category expansion and flexibility in our supply chainSupporting the product development creation processPartnering with Design, Product Creation Development, Supply Chain, and our external vendors to provide continuous improvements in speed, scalability, efficiency, and consistency in our development to manufacturing processProviding the seasonal timeline targets and delivery plan for your product and/or factory portfolioWorking with the Product Integrity team to ensure our vendor base understands, utilizes and supports the evolution of construction standardsSupporting the Compliance team in ensuring all testing requirements are consistently metBuilding strong partnerships with our vendor base ensuring our expectations of our Product Creation and Commercialization process are explicit and deliverables achievable in the expected timeUpholding Fair Labor Association’s Workplace Code of Conduct and Principles of Fair Labor and Responsible Sourcing throughout the Arc’teryx supply chainWorking closely with the Amer Sports Global Sourcing Vendor Sustainability team on quarterly business reviews and training/capacity buildingAdhering to negotiated lead times and balanced annual capacities to expedite responsible purchasing practices as outlined in the Responsible Sourcing PolicyFuture workPart of building SOPs between Product Creation Development and CommercialisationBuilding and hiring a team of technical specialists for the appropriate product categories.Training on our development and quality standards/processes and planning training for future hiresCollaborating on cross‑functional projectsRequirementsBachelor’s degree, preferably in Apparel or Textile Design, Technology, Merchandising, or Engineering8+ years’ experience in sourcing, design, development, production, or merchandising, ideally including 3+ years’ experience in people leadershipStrong knowledge of apparel construction, material construction and properties, pattern making, costing, bill of materials, embroidery, and surface applicationsProven skills in problem solving, interpreting design intent and product innovationProven performance history with domestic and offshore vendors and manufacturersStrong verbal and written communication skillsExtreme attention to detailAble to travel globally, as needed, to support the business expectationsStrong prioritization skills and the ability to manage multiple prioritiesStrong computer skills in Adobe Illustrator and Microsoft OfficeSet a clear vision, align your team around common objectives, and foster commitment to these objectivesProactive in identifying the root cause of issues and developing solutionsHighly flexible and adaptable when faced with ambiguityBalance of autonomy and collaborationInspire breakthrough thinking and continuous improvementSeek the best (sometimes not the easiest) solutions, with an unwavering commitment to do what is rightPassion for the work and a love for the outdoorsEqual OpportunityArc’teryx is committed to actively creating and fostering a culture of inclusivity where voices are heard, people are seen, and values are respected.
